The AirTAC Airtac ACPJ Adjustable Compact Cylinder ACPJ12X125-100S is a double acting, adjustable stroke DIN-standard tight/compact air cylinder with a Ø12mm bore and 125mm stroke, M5×0.8 air ports and a hard-anodized aluminium body. This model is discontinued — the current-production replacement is the ACEJ12X125-100S (ISO 21287 ACE), in the same bore, stroke and force class.
Double acting and adjustable, the ACPJ12X125-100S is a discontinued DIN-standard compact cylinder with a 12 mm bore and a 125 mm stroke trimmed by a 100 mm stop-screw window, so the extend stroke can be set anywhere between 25 and 125 mm on site. At 0.5 MPa it pushes 56.5 N and pulls 42.4 N; at 0.7 MPa those figures rise to 79.2 N and 59.4 N. The 125 mm stroke exceeds the 50 mm standard limit for bore 12, so it is made to order.
The short ISO 21287-class body saves about 50% of the mounting length of an ISO 15552 profile cylinder, which suits cramped slide assemblies and guarding. Because roughly 60% of the 56.5 N push is realistic working force, plan on about 34 N of usable push, which lifts about 3.4 kg vertically - or about 1.7 kg with a 2:1 margin. The -S magnet is fitted, so CMSE / DMSE switches can be mounted. This model is discontinued; the current drop-in is ACEJ12X125 - confirm ISO 21287 mounting dimensions before swapping.

Replacement mapping (swap P for E): ACP→ACE, ASP→ASE, ATP→ATE, ACPD→ACED, ACPJ→ACEJ. ACP-family: ACP (double acting), ASP / ATP (single acting push / pull), ACPD (double rod), ACPJ (adjustable stroke).

At 12 mm bore this is the smallest force class: 56.5 N push at 0.5 MPa. If the load needs more, step up to bore 16 (100.5 N) or bore 20 (157.1 N) in the same compact family. The stop screw only trims the extend stroke and does not hold a load - on air loss the piston drifts, so add an external stop where holding matters. Replacement checklist
At 0.5 MPa it pushes 56.5 N and pulls 42.4 N; at 0.7 MPa, 79.2 N push and 59.4 N pull; theoretical maximum is 11.5 kgf at 1.0 MPa. Operating pressure is 0.15-1.0 MPa (22-145 psi), proof 1.5 MPa (215 psi), speed 30-500 mm/s, temperature -20 to +70 C, air filtered to 40 um. Port is M5x0.8, rod thread is female M3x0.5, and the 125 mm stroke is a made-to-order length above the 50 mm standard for bore 12.
The -100 code is a 100 mm window: an external stop screw shortens the 125 mm extend stroke to any setting from 25 mm up, with fixed TPU bumpers at both ends. The stop is a mechanical end stop, not a mid-stroke lock, so the piston still drifts on air loss. This ACPJ is discontinued; the current drop-in is ACEJ12X125 (same bore, stroke and force class) - confirm ISO 21287 mounting dimensions before swapping.
